The proposed research project will assess the humus- and fertilizer-value of organic residues with a particular focus an residues from biogas production. In subproject 2 organic residues, in particular digestates from Biogas production will be chemically characterized (total C, organic C, water soluble C, C in van Soest fractions: NDF, ADF, ADL, total N, mineral N, water-soluble N, N in van Soest fractions, total P, water-soluble P, citrate-soluble P, CAL-soluble P, P in Hedley fractions). %sults of chemical characterization are used to predict C, N and P dynamics in incubation experiments. For the same purpose, data of pot and field experiments are used from the other working groups. Finally, data from the chemical characterization and the incubation studies are provided for mode) development. This study aims to improve fertilization advice and nutrient efficiency in agricultural practice and serves also for information of policy makers.
